Jump to content

dev botao

NFSE : PROBLEMA DE TIMEOUT DE REQUISIÇÃO : SOMENTE EM MODO DE PRODUÇÃO


Go to solution Solved by Victor H. Gonzales - Panda,
  • Este tópico foi criado há 858 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Recommended Posts

  • Membros Pro

Prezados
Companheiros

Estou novamente com problemas na Emissão da NFSe para a GINFES.
Esta aplicação utiliza o componente : AcbrNFSe.

Recentemente eu havia solicitado auxílio e fui atendido pelo Sr. Ítalo.
Na oportunidade o Sr. Ítalo me sugeriu para resolver o erro aumentar o valor da Propriedade Timeout para 30000.

Isto resolveu o problema na Transmissão da NFSe em modo Homologação, vejam :
image.png.78e200e3867c2c6cdf599aacf3b7487e.png

Inclusive as Notas Fiscais aparecem no Site do Ginfes, vejam :
image.thumb.png.91a0227dc5e3b8dee7e62f51891ffc6d.png

Mas o problema retorna novamente quando o Cliente foi efetuar a transmissão em Modo de : Produção, vejam:

image.png.4c2d51f099e91801cb88ae653dea89f6.png

Questionado, o GINFES parece totalmente alheio ao meu problema!
Eu pedi para eles pesquisarem no Log de seu Servidor alguma informação que nos pudesse dar uma idéia do que está provocando o problema, mas sejam o que eles responderam :

image.thumb.png.a9d57eb5b33f4b82c84053dd062bc12e.png

Assim, gostaria de solicitar ajuda novamente dos senhores, para ver se tem alguma outra sugestão para eu tentar resolver este problema.

Mas tenho crença firme que o problema está no GINFES, mas eles não parecem muito interessados em ajudar.

Grato pela ajuda.
 

Link to comment
Share on other sites

  • Consultores
  • Solution

Boa tarde,

o WSDL no final da url só irá expor os métodos, não irá ajudar em muita coisa você.

Acredito que estamos falando do ACBrNFSeX, você pode debugar a classe de envio e verificar onde está sendo enviado o envelope, mas tu pode olhar o ACBrNFSeXServicos.ini que irá gerar um resouces

[Ginfes]
ProRecepcionar=https://producao.ginfes.com.br/ServiceGinfesImpl
;
HomRecepcionar=https://homologacao.ginfes.com.br/ServiceGinfesImpl

 

, mas no seu próprio diálogo está informando qual a url que está acessando que houve a violação de timeout.

mas em todo o caso, nota de serviço é uma caixinha de surpresas, se em homologação "funciona", primeira coisa é tu verificar se via navegador tu consegue acessar a url só para descartar algum bloqueio da estrutura de rede (que é esse teste de WSDL) que o suporte te solicitou.

 

Minha sugestão é, na hora do envio,  é capturar o erro de timeout (30k de timeout é um tempo legal) subir uma thread no gestor de documentos, e fazer uns 5 a 7 tentativas com intervalos de pelo menos uns 10 segundos entre elas, se assim não tiver sucesso ai devolver a mensagem na tela para o usuário.

Consultor SAC ACBr

Victor H Gonzales - Pandaaa
Ajude o Projeto ACBr crescer - Assine o SAC

Projeto ACBr     Telefone:(15) 2105-0750 WhatsApp(15)99790-2976.  Discord

Projeto ACBr - A maior comunidade Open Source de Automação Comercial do Brasil

Participe de nosso canal no Discord e fique ainda mais próximo da Comunidade !!

"Aprender é a única coisa que a mente nunca se cansa, nunca tem medo e nunca se arrepende” - Leonardo da Vinci

"Ter sucesso é falhar repetidamente, mas sem perder o entusiasmo"

Link to comment
Share on other sites

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.

The popup will be closed in 10 seconds...